Justin Bieber has given his latest single, "Boyfriend", another remix treatment. After collaborating with Ying Yang Twins in one reworked version, the "Mistletoe" singer added more Hip-Hop feel to the Mike Posner-produced tune by teaming up with 2 Chainz, Asher Roth and Mac Miller.

2 Chainz kicks off the star-studded remix with a verse about giving his girlfriend anything, and Roth makes a reference to the 18-year-old pop sensation and his girlfriend, Selena Gomez, in his verse. "We could be like Selena and Biebs, wild and free, a couple disobedient teens," he spits. "Sneaking out to meet around like 2 o'clock in the eve/Paparazzi in the bar and we just hot in the beach."

Bieber himself expressed his excitement over the new remix just hours before sharing it to his fans. "WHAT?!??! my bro @asherroth just sent me a verse for the #BFREMIX !! crazy! adding him to it! so dope. @2chainz @macmiller @asherroth #REMIX," he tweeted on Thursday, May 24. He then wrote, "get #BOYFRIENDRemix as the #1 TT and I will give it to @mikewaxx @illroots to post!"

Remix aside, Bieber has sent his Vancouver-based fans reeling over the fact that the city didn't make it into the list of his North American tour stops. Manager Scooter Braun, however, tried to assure them that the "Baby" hitmaker will take his road show to promote his new album, "Believe", there.

"u really think we would put @carlyraejepsen on the tour and not hit vancouver?? sit tight :)," Braun tweeted. "the @JustinBieber #BELIEVEtour is coming with @carlyraejepsen and ??? :) #BiggestPOPtourOfTheYear." Opening act Carly Rae Jepsen herself wrote on her account, "Don't worry Vancouver, we will be coming there with the #BELIEVEtour ! So #callmemaybe #vancouverwantsBELIEVETOUR !!"
